Living Legend
Woe and angst is me, for I am petty and weak, not to mention confused with my many personalities, infinite powers, and not to forget undecided in my sexual orientation.”
- Sorak, the Crown of the Elves

Sorak was a fine example of the "Living Legend" syndrome. Receiving all the training in the world in the arts of druidry, melee combat, psionic arts and ranger survival, he always felt he was alone and misunderstood. The reason for this, rather disturbed state of mind was the fact he had multiple personalities, each more powerful than the other. No matter they all lived in almost perfect unison, worked as one wherever their life was in danger (or when they simply wanted some fun by cheating at the casino table) Sorak was deeply insecure and always felt impotent. As he grew popular by doing some rather drastic and famous deeds, he became more and more unhappy with his state of mind. Once he finally managed to get rid of the other personalities, through a very complicated and epic quest, not to mention after three books of complaining and whining, he felt so alone and bitter I almost threw the book to trash. Almost.

This prestige class is a lot different than your usual prestige classes, simply because of it's very strict requirements. However, once met, it provides a potential player a vast number of advantages.

Hit Die: Flip a coin. Use of psionic powers to determine (or influence) the outcome is not prohibited. If it's heads use d12, otherwise use d20.

Requirements
To qualify to become a Living Legend, a character must fulfill all the following criteria.
Region: Somewhere in the Ringing Mountains.
Alignment: Any.
Special: Must have been trained almost from birth in a very strict and completely non-described monastic sanctuary although there are no monks on Athas.
Special: Must be a non-playable, fictitious or otherwise non-stated race. Dwelf is a good example.
Special: Must have a very important figure for grandfather, without knowing it. Fabricated or also fictitious (from beyond the tablelands) Sorcerer-Kings are allowed.
Special: Character must be a virgin, ie, never had sex with anyone.
Special: Must have all base stats equal or higher than 17.
Special: Must be vegetarian, no matter that'd be suicide on Athas.
Special: Must have fragmented personality. At character creation roll d%, divide by 3, and use that number as your "known" personalities. Half are male, other half are female. Others are dormant.
Special: The Living Legend to be must whine constantly about him being underpowered. Failure to do so at any possible opportunity makes him an Ex-Living Legend. Having sex with any PC or NPC also results in losing the prestige class.

Note there are no BAB of Feat requirements. They are not necessary.

Class Skills:
The Living Legend has all skills as class skills, due to vast chance that some of dormant personalities has that knowledge.


Skill Points at Each Level: 10 + Int modifier.
CL BAB F R W Special<br /> 1st +1 +2 +2 +2 Artifact weapon, +1 level of any manifesting class/+1 level of any divine class<br /> 2nd +2 +3 +3 +3 Fame +10, kreen mental set +1 level of any manifesting class/+1 level of any divine class<br /> 3rd +3 +3 +3 +3 Mystic surge, Unexplainable insight, +1 level of any manifesting class/+1 level of any divine class<br /> 4th +4 +4 +4 +4 Unlock personalities 1, +1 level of any manifesting class/+1 level of any divine class<br /> 5th +5 +4 +4 +4 Fame +20, +1 level of any manifesting class/+1 level of any divine class<br /> 6th +6 +5 +5 +5 Power-up, +1 level of any manifesting class/+1 level of any divine class<br /> 7th +7 +5 +5 +5 Locate wealth, +1 level of any manifesting class/+1 level of any divine class<br /> 8th +8 +6 +6 +6 Unlock personalities 2, +1 level of any manifesting class/+1 level of any divine class<br /> 9th +9 +6 +6 +6 Fame +30, +1 level of any manifesting class/+1 level of any divine class<br /> 10th +10 +7 +7 +7 Woe and Angst, +1 level of any manifesting class/+1 level of any divine class
